Had mine for about a year and a half. For the first 4 or 5 batches I left it at the factory setting, but then regapped it to .035" and holy cow - my effiency skyrocketed! I use a drill with mine and as long as you keep the rpms low you will be real happy with it. I have run close to 300 lbs through my BC and am a happy camper!

Same here, reset it to .035 and I am routinely in the mid 80's for efficiency. I use a 1/2" drill and go as slow as I can. I also condition the grain prior to milling.
 
Yep, I'm really happy with mine. The only "problem" I have had was my rubber washer falling off after the 3rd or 4th milling.

The only thing that I wish that I would have changed would be getting the large hopper. Again, a great product.
